Fattah-1 vs Iskander-M: Side-by-Side Comparison & Analysis
Overview
The Fattah-1 and Iskander-M are two advanced missile systems with different design philosophies and capabilities. The Fattah-1 is a hypersonic medium-range ballistic missile with a maneuverable glide vehicle, while the Iskander-M is a short-range ballistic missile with a quasi-ballistic trajectory. Side-by-Side Specifications
| Dimension | Fattah 1 | Iskander M |
|---|---|---|
| Range | 1400 km | 500 km |
| Speed | Mach 13-15 | Mach 6-7 |
| Guidance | INS with HGV | INS + GLONASS + optical terminal correlation + radar scene matching |
| Warhead | Maneuverable hypersonic glide vehicle with conventional payload | 480kg HE, cluster, thermobaric, or nuclear |
| First Deployed | 2023 | 2006 |
| Unit Cost (USD) | Unknown | ~$3M per missile |
| Operators | Iran | Russia, Belarus, Armenia, Algeria |
| Combat Record | Iran claims use during October 2024 attack on Israel | Heavily used in Ukraine conflict since 2022 |
| Strengths | Claimed hypersonic speed, maneuvering flight path, depressed trajectory | Quasi-ballistic trajectory, terminal maneuver capability, multiple warhead options |
| Weaknesses | Claims largely unverified, HGV technology extremely difficult, production likely very limited | Expensive per missile, limited range, some intercepted by Patriot in Ukraine |
